Low Slope
A quality membrane roofing system will provide long-lasting protection for the low-slope areas of your home (e.g., porches, garages, car ports, sun rooms, etc.) without the danger or hassles associated with conventional roofing products. Liberty™ systems are safer because they are applied without torches, open flames, hot asphalt, or messy solvent-based adhesives.view more...
Metal
A steel shingle or paneled roof is the permanent roofing solution that offers you far more than any other roofing product. These roofs offer a dramatic advantage over traditional materials, they don't rot, crack, split, or break and they're even fire resistant for added protection. Steel roofs come in a variety of colors and styles. From the handhewn texture of wood to the classic elegance of slate or copper you can choose the right combination of appearance and durability for virtually every roofing application. view more...
